Ok guys, thanks for all your input. I have some info, please feel free to share as I will continue to check this thread for updates.
I found a shipping company called Global in Japan (was referred by a Tokyo Porsche dealer). Basically, Global will take care of all shipping, emissions, testing, registration and taxes. Cost is approximately $10,300 and takes about 4 weeks.
Unfortunately, my lease does not allow me to ship the car overseas.... I could buy the car outright and then ship it, but Im not too sure about that. I guess I have to put the car up for sale.
